Sei sulla pagina 1di 5

c   cc


El diccionario de datos guarda y organiza los detalles del Diagrama de Flujo de Datos.
Es el segundo componente del análisis estructurado. También se conoce como "Data
Repository". Incluye el contenido de los data flow (flujos de datos), los "data store", las
entidades externas y los procesos.

c   

  Es la parte más pequeña de los datos que tiene
significado en el sistema de información. Se combinan varios elementos de datos para
hacer los records o "data structures". Ejemplo: nombre, dirección, seguro social.

c     

   También se conocen como record. Es la
combinación de elementos de datos relacionados que se incluye en un flujo de datos o
se retiene en un "data store".

c

c  .- Las características que se describen en el diccionario de datos son:

1. p ame. Es el nombre del elemento de datos; debe ser significativo.


2. p Alias. Cualquier otro nombre que se pueda usar para referirse al elemento de
datos. Por ejemplo, el nombre de un elemento de datos puede ser Balance actual,
y el alias puede ser Deuda. Solo se incluye el alias si realmente es necesario
utilizarlo.
3. p Type y Size. Type o tipo se refiere a si el elemento de datos contiene valor
numérico, caracteres o alfabético. Size o tamaño se refiere al máximo de
caracteres o de dígitos que puede tener el elemento de datos.
4. p Output format or edit mask. Indica cómo se presenta el dato al mostrarse en
pantalla o al imprimirse en un reporte. Por ejemplo, el número de teléfono del
cliente se puede guardar en el disco usando solo números 7878889999, pero
presentarse editado en la pantalla o en el reporte (787) 888 -9999.
5. p Default value. Es el valor que el elemento de datos tiene si no se cambia entrando
otro valor.
6. p Prompt column header or field caption. Es el nombre que se presenta en la
pantalla o el título del dato en el reporte.
7. p Source. De dónde se origina el valor del elemento de datos. Puede ser una forma,
un departamento, otro sistema, etc.
8. p Security. Identifica los individuos o departamentos que pueden modificar el
elemento de datos. Por ejemplo, la línea de crédito puede ser cambiada por el
gerente de crédito.
9. p Responsible user(s). Identifica el (los) usuarios responsables de entrar o cambiar los
valores del elemento de datos.
10. pAcceptable Data and Data validation. Se especifica el dominio o valores permitidos.
Pueden ser valores específicos, una lista de valores, los valores que se encuentren
en otro archivo, etc. El valor puede tener reglas de validación; por ejemplo, el
salario debe estar entre lo permitido para la posición que el empleado ocupa.
11. pDerivation formula. Si el valor es el resultado de un cálculo, se muestra la fórmula
que se utiliza.
12. pDescription or comments. Para proveer información adicional, notas o
descripciones.

c     



  .- Las características que se describen en el flujo de datos
son:

1. p ame. El nombre del flujo de datos tal y como aparece en el DFD.


2. p Alias. Otro nombre con que se conozca el flujo de datos.
3. p Abbreviation or ID. Código que provee acceso rápido al flujo de datos en un
diccionario de datos automatizado.
4. p Description. Describe el flujo de datos y su propósito.
5. p Origin. De donde sale (la fuente) el flujo de datos. Puede ser un proceso, un ͞data
store͟ o una entidad.
6. p Destination. El punto final del flujo de datos en el DFD. Puede ser un proceso, un
͞data store͟ o una entidad.
7. p Record. Cada flujo de datos representa un grupo de elementos de da tos
relacionados, o un record. Los records y los flujos de datos se definen por separado
para que más de un flujo de datos o ͞data store͟ pueda hacer referencia al mismo
record.
8. p Volume and frequency. Describe el número esperado de ocurrencias para el flujo
de datos por unidad de tiempo.

Xc   .- Las características que se describen en el ͞data store͟ son:

1. p ame. El nombre del ͞data store͟ según aparece en el DFD.


2. p Alias. Otro nombre con el que se pueda llamar al ͞data store͟.
3. p Abbreviation or ID. Código que provee un acceso rápido al ͞data store͟ en un
diccionario de datos automatizado.
4. p Description. Describe el ͞data store͟ y su propósito.
5. p Input data flows. Los nombres de los flujos de datos que entran al ͞data store͟.
6. p Output data flows. Los nombres de los flujos de datos que salen del ͞data store͟.
7. p Record. El nombre del record en el diccionario de datos para el ͞data store͟.
8. p Volume and Frequency. El número estimado de records guardados en el ͞data
store͟, al igual que el aumento o cambio esperado.

D  .- Se documenta cada función primitiva. Se incluye:

1. p Process name or label. El nombre del proceso como aparece en el DFD.


2. p Purpose or description. Un resumen del propósito general del proceso. Los detalles
se documentan en el Process Description.
3. p Process number. úmero de referencia que identifica el proceso y su relación con
los niveles del sistema.
4. p Input data flows. Los nombres de los flujos de datos que entran al proceso.
5. p Output data flows. Los nombres de los flujos de datos que salen del proces o.
6. p Process Description. Se explican los detalles del proceso.



! .- Las características que se describen son:

1. p ame
2. p Alias
3. p Description. Describe a la entidad y su propósito.
4. p Input data flow
5. p Output data flow

Y 
.- Se describe lo siguiente:

1. p Record name
2. p Alias
3. p Description
4. p Record content or composition . Una lista de todos los elementos de datos incluidos
en el record. Se identifica cualquier ͞key͟ primario, o sea un elemento de datos en
el record que identifica en for ma única al record.

Y" DY #"$


1. p Para manejar los detalles en sistemas muy grandes, ya que tienen enormes
cantidades de datos, aun en los sistemas más chicos hay gran cantidad de datos.
Los sistemas al sufrir cambios continuos, es muy difícil manejar todos los detalles.
Por eso se registra la información, ya sea sobre hoja de papel o usando
procesadores de texto. Los analistas mas organizados usan el diccionario de datos
automatizados diseñados específicamente para el análisis y diseño de software.

2. p Para asignarle un solo significado a cada uno de los elementos y actividades del
sistema. Los diccionarios de datos proporcionan asistencia para asegurar
significados comunes para los elementos y actividades del sistema y registrando
detalles adicionales relacionados con el flujo de datos en el sistema, de tal manera
que todo pueda localizarse con rapidez.

3. p Para documentar las características del sistema, incluyendo partes o componentes


así como los aspectos que los distinguen. También es necesario saber bajo qué
circunstancias se lleva a cabo cada proceso y con qué frecuencia ocurren.
Produciendo una comprensión más completa. Una vez que las características están
articuladas y registradas, todos los participantes en el proyecto tendrán una fuente
común de información con respecto al sistema.
4. p Para facilitar el análisis de los detalles con la finalidad de evaluar las características
y determinar donde efectuar cambios en el sistema. Determina si son necesarias
nuevas características o si están en orden los cambios de cualquier tipo. Se
abordan las características:
Ëp aturaleza de las transacciones: las actividades de la empresa que se llevan a
cabo mientras se emplea el sistema.
Ëp Preguntas: solicitudes para la recuperación o procesamiento de información
para generar una respuesta especifica.
Ëp Archivos y bases de datos: detalles de las transacciones y registros maestros
que son de interés para la organización.
Ëp Capacidad del sistema: Habilidad del sistema para aceptar, procesar y
almacenar transacciones y datos.

5. p Localizar errores y omisiones en el sistema, detectan dificultades, y las presentan


en un informe. Aun en los manuales, se revelan errores.

ccY% Yc#cY 
El diccionario tiene dos tipos de descripciones para el flujo de datos del sistema, son
los elementos datos y estructura de datos.

 
 
Son los bloques básicos para todos los demás datos del sistema, por si mismos no le
dan un significado suficiente al usuario. Se agrupan para formar una estructura de
datos.

c & ' Cada entrada en el diccionario consiste de un conjunto de detalles que
describen los datos utilizados o producidos por el sistema. Cada uno está identificado
con: Un nombre: para distinguir un dato de otro. Descripción: indica lo que representa
en el sistema. Alias: porque un dato puede recibir varios nombres, dependiendo de
quién uso este dato. Longitud: porque es de importancia de saber la cantidad de
espacio necesario para cada dato. Valores de los datos: porque en algunos procesos
solo son permitidos valores muy específicos para los datos. Si los valores de los datos
están restringidos a un intervalo especifico, esto debe estar en la entrada del
diccionario.

 

  
Es un grupo de datos que están relacionados con otros y que en conjunto descr iben un
componente del sistema.

c & ': Se construyen sobre cuatro relaciones de componentes. Se pueden


utilizar las siguientes combinaciones ya sea individualmente o en conjunción con
alguna otra.
Y  '  : define los componentes que siempre se incluyen en una
estructura de datos.

Y  '
 ': (uno u otro), define las alternativas para datos o estructuras de
datos incluidos en una estructura de datos.

Y  '
   ': (repetitiva), define la repetición de un componente. Relación
opcional: los datos pueden o no estar incluidos, o sea, una o ninguna iteración.

   '
Los analistas usan símbolos especiales con la finalidad de no usar demasiada cantidad
de texto para la descripción de las relaciones entre datos y mostrar con claridad las
relaciones estructurales. En algunos casos se emplean términos diferentes para
describir la misma entidad (alias) estos se representan con un signo igual (=) que
vincula los datos.

Potrebbero piacerti anche